City - Richardson

Richardson, Texas, sits at the crossroads of Dallas and Collin counties, functioning as a well-established inner suburb that draws on proximity to both Dallas and Plano without feeling like a satellite of either. The city's identity is anchored by the University of Texas at Dallas and the renowned Telecom Corridor, a concentrated stretch hosting major names in telecommunications and technology, including AT&T, Cisco Systems, Samsung, and Texas Instruments. Blue Cross Blue Shield of Texas is also headquartered here, giving the local economy a broad, diversified foundation.

Neighborhoods like Canyon Creek and Heights Park offer a settled, tree-lined character, while the CityLine district delivers a more contemporary pace with walkable mixed-use development. The Charles W. Eisemann Center for Performing Arts brings Broadway tours and classical performances to residents throughout the year.
